For the 2025 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 3,065 students in 55331, MN (there are 2 private schools, serving 202 private students). 94% of all K-12 students in 55331, MN are educated in public schools (compared to the MN state average of 90%).
The top ranked public schools in 55331, MN are Excelsior Elementary School, Minnetonka West Middle School and Minnewashta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 55331 have an average math proficiency score of 71% (versus the Minnesota public school average of 45%), and reading proficiency score of 72% (versus the 51% statewide average). Schools in 55331, MN have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 5% of Minnesota public schools.
Minority enrollment is 21% of the student body (majority Asian and Hispanic), which is less than the Minnesota public school average of 39% (majority Black and Hispanic).
